BN25 4ZQ is a small residential postcode in East Sussex, nestled within the coastal town of Seaford. With a population of just 1,503, it reflects the quiet, unassuming character of the area. Seaford, located at the mouth of the River Ouse, has a history spanning thousands of years, from Saxon settlements to its role as a Cinque Port in the 13th century. Today, it functions as a modest seaside town and dormitory community for nearby cities like Brighton, Eastbourne, and London. The area’s charm lies in its historical legacy, modest scale, and proximity to rail networks. Residents benefit from easy access to Seaford’s seafront, though the town has not developed into a major tourist hub. The postcode covers a small cluster of homes, predominantly houses, with a strong sense of local identity. Its rail connections to Lewes and London, combined with a population skewed toward middle-aged homeowners, create a community that balances historical roots with modern practicality.
